Remark: From PI volume (1931) description: Similar to Kenya Governor, but is resistant to both physiologic forms of stem rust, nos. 17 and 21. Susceptible to leaf rust. Does not yield as well as Kenya Governor, but has stronger straw and tigher chaff. History: DEVELOPED Rift Valley, Kenya by Plant Breeding Station
